Kiniro Mosaic (Golden Mosaic)

Shinobu Omiya once stayed in England, where she met and befriended Alice Cartelet. Years later when Shinobu is in high school, Alice comes to Japan as an exchange student and the two renew their friendship.

Tonight’s Episode:Golden Times” Finale

It’s the start of a new school year and Alice is excited. Shino and Karen share her enthusiasm, looking forward to all the new experiences that await them in the coming year. Aya is less enthused, as a new school year means reassignment of students to classes.

Preview – Soul Eater Not!

DWMA (Death Weapon Meister Academy) is the place to go if you find that you are able the change into a weapon and need to master your newfound ability. Which is how Harudori Tsugumi finds herself in the United States, as part of the new class of students at the academy. Here she will learn to control her power and team up with one of the meisters (Students training to wield Death Weapons). However, she can’t quite make her mind up about which one to team up with.

Tonight’s Episode:Enrolling at DWMA!

Harudori Tsugumi discovered her latent weapon-transforming ability purely by accident one evening whilst trying to avoid the family dog, now she’s been transferred to DWMA. Her former classmates find it all terribly exciting, although Tsugumi finds the attention somewhat embarrassing. Upon her arrival at Death City Airport she finds herself mobbed by the various hawkers and taxi drivers looking for business, and in the process of fending them off misses two other new students of DWMA at the airport …

Preview – Baby Steps

Eichirou Maruo is the most diligent student in his school, his notes are so perfect and complete that there is not a student in the school that doesn’t want a copy (and Maruo makes sure to have several handy). But a chance encounter with the school’s most adored female student, Natsu Takasaki, presents him with something new to focus his rigorous note-taking skills upon …. Tennis!

Tonight’s Episode:Tennis and Notes

At the Kanagawa Junior Tennis Circuit a spiky haired teenager is in the middle of tennis match. The spectators are surprise to learn he only started playing a year ago. Despite pushing himself to the limit, the spiky haired teen loses the point. And then surprises the spectators once again when he sits down to take notes. A year earlier the highlight of honour student Maruo’s day was fitting all the notes from his math class onto just five pages.

Log Horizon

Elder Tale is an MMO with over twenty million players world wide. When a new expansion is added to the game, Shiro and his friends find themselvers amongst the several hundred thousand players across the world that are now literally trapped inside the game.

Tonight’s Episode:World Fraction

Whilst Minori and her party continue to struggle with the monsters in the Lagrandia dungeon the Round Table has divided up their various social invitations, with Crusty taking great pleasure in teasing the flustered Princess Lenissia. But now near the end of all the socialising Shiroe has been approached by a strange new person, Regan of Miral Lake. This mysterious mage has invited Shiroe and Akatsuki to his library, and Shiroe is beginning to get an idea of just how important he might be. The Sage of Miral Lake studies ‘World-class Magic’ …

Gin no Saji (Silver Spoon)

What’s it like to live and work on a farm? Get ready to find out. Join Yugo Hachiken, newly enrolled student at Oezo Agricultural High School, as he learns the details of modern agriculture and farm life from both his instructors and his fellow students.

Tonight’s Episode:Take Off Running, Hachiken” Finale

Hachiken even went so far as to personally care for him, and fatten him up, before it was too late. But now the fateful day is approaching, Pork Bowl will soon be on his way to the slaughterhouse. Hachiken’s antics have also rubbed off on his classmates, Yoshino even stops him one morning whilst he is feeding the pigs to comment on it. How his agonizing over the fate of Pork Bowl has made her and the rest of the class think about how they simply took the whole process for granted.

Galilei Donna

Hozuki, Kazuki and Hazuki Ferrari have endured many lectures from their mother about how they must live up to the legacy of their illustrious ancestor Galileo Galilei. But when shadowy groups start attacking them to get to “Galileo’s Inheritance” they discover their ancestry may be more important than they ever suspected.

Tonight’s Episode:Galileo Judge” Finale

The chase has ended, although not as anyone intended. The Ferrari sisters are in the custody of Interpol rather than dead at the hands of Roberto, and the Adni Moon Company is set to frame them for all the Methane Hydrate thefts they carried out. The court case looms but the president of Adni Moon claims he can make it all go away, if they will give him the Galileo Tesoro. Meanwhile their mother continues her work for Adni Moon, her amnesia having removed all memory of her daughters, and Anna sits huddled in a prison cell wondering what punishment awaits after her betrayal.

Samurai Flamenco

Hazama Masayoshi; male model by day, superhero by night. Or at least, that is the plan. With no super powers, no high tech gadgets, and no real training, enthusiasm is the only thing Hazama has to help him battle the drunk office workers and truant teenagers of Tokyo. Police officer Hidenori Goto becomes an unwilling accomplice to the exploits of ‘Samurai Flamenco’ and along the way they both learn what it truly means to be a hero of justice.

Tonight’s Episode:From Beyond

King Torture has been defeated and his final maniacal plan thwarted by the efforts of Hazama and Gotou. Believing his struggles to be over, Hazama has now revealed his identity to the world as the TV crews gathered around the destroyed base. But in the middle of his reveal, his mentor Kaname appears in full Red Axe costume as a massive structure rises out of Tokyo Bay. Before any real explanation can be given a high tech VTOL craft appears and whisks away Hazama and Kaname. King Torture may be gone, but an enemy a thousand times stronger has now revealed itself.

Kyoukai no Kanata (Beyond the Boundary)

Akihito Kanbara is the half-human son of a dreamshade. Although never completely normal his life becomes a little more exciting when he meets Mirai Kuriyama, the last surviving member of a cursed clan of dreamshade hunters, and Akihito takes it upon himself to help her integrate with the other spirit warriors of their town and boost her confidence.

Tonight’s Episode:Black World World

Kuriyama has sacrificed herself rather than kill Akihito, the first person to treat her like a normal girl rather than a cursed monster. And now battles the Kyoukai no Kanata within its own dimensional realm. Their duel has already persisted for the three months that Akihito was in a coma, yet he still hears the distant thunder of Kuriyama’s battle. The others can hear nothing but their spirit powers have weakened, and Aikawa suspects a link between the two. To make matters worse, Fujima of the Dreamshade Hunters Association has not finished meddling …

Kill la Kill

Ryuko Matoi is a girl on a mission; to find the person responsible for her father’s death. Her search has led her to Honnouji Academy, a brutal, totalitarian school where the student council, led by Satsuki Kiryuin and empowered by their Ultima Uniforms, rule over everyone else. Ryuko quickly finds herself at odds with Satsuki’s dictatorship, but aid comes to Ryuko both from unexpected allies within the school … and a set of skimpy talking clothes.

Tonight’s Episode:Spit Your Sadness Away

Sanageyama’s battle with Ryuuko was cut incredibly short by the appearance of the pink frilly stranger Harime Nui, who unravelled his Ultima Uniform with the flick of her little finger. Nui is a servant of Satsuki’s mother Ragyou, the Grand Couturier (head tailor) of her clothing company, although she is at Honnouji Academy for her own amusement rather than official business. But far worse than that, Nui reveals that it was she who killed Ryuuko’s father by producing the second half of the Sword Scissor … and Ryuuko does not take the news well.
